of inispraise m the employ of the Meat Compan- and that is Mjc Hariris, or 'Arris, or whatever it is ; he is employed. in that sausage or dog mystery room' and is AS POPULAR AS A DEFUNCT RABBIT which has been deceased some .time. This individual is secretary to the Butchers' Union, and gets paid for his services, and many people wonder how he even got that job. He was m business on his own account m Christchurch once, but he doesn't seem to have made a millionaire of himself. In fact, from all accounts', it was just the opposite, and he. only had himself to blame. Be that as it may, he is now hand m glove with bosker boss Merritt, and the men know it to their cost. There is a great deal to be said about the meat ! trade m Christchurch. but it will have to stand over' for the present. Meanwhile if a Christchurch Meat Company man chances to hit a dog on the nose with a piece q$ sausage meat he is apt to be sacked instanter.
